Can I monitor a file with extension .splunk?

Trying to monitor a file that ends with .splunk but for some reason splunk will not index it. Only when I change the extension to .txt, it ingests. Any reasons why this is happening?

This is the reason:

Files with a .splunk filename extension are also not monitored, because files with that extension contain Splunk metadata. If you need to index files with a .splunk extension, use the add oneshot CLI command.
